A C-beli calloc függvény meghatározott mennyiségű memória lefoglalására, majd nullára történő inicializálására használatos A függvény egy üres mutatót ad vissza erre a memóriahelyre, amely ezután öntsük a kívánt típusra. A függvény két paramétert vesz fel, amelyek együttesen határozzák meg a lefoglalandó memória mennyiségét.
Miért használják a calloc függvényt a C programokban?
A calloc C-ben egy függvény, amellyel több, azonos méretű memóriablokkot foglalnak le … A Malloc függvény egyetlen memóriablokk lefoglalására szolgál, míg a calloc függvény C-ben több memóriablokk lefoglalására szolgál. A C programozás során a calloc által lefogl alt minden blokk azonos méretű.
Mire használható a malloc és calloc a C-ben?
A Malloc függvény egyetlen memóriablokk lefoglalására szolgál, míg a C-beli calloc több memóriablokk lefoglalására szolgál. A calloc függvény által lefogl alt minden blokk azonos méretű.
Miért van szükség calloc-ra?
A Calloc funkció több memóriablokk lefoglalására szolgál Ez egy dinamikus memóriafoglalási funkció, amely a memória komplex adatstruktúrákhoz, például tömbökhöz és struktúrákhoz való hozzárendelésére szolgál. Ha ez a függvény nem tud elegendő helyet foglalni a megadott módon, akkor nullmutatót ad vissza.
Miért használják a calloc függvényt a C programokban Mcq?
A calloc függvény n objektumból álló tömb számára foglal helyet, amelyek méretét a méret határozza meg. A tér minden bitje nullára van inicializálva. Magyarázat: void calloc(size-t n, size-t size); Ez a függvény a kért memória lefoglalására szolgál, és egy mutatót ad vissza rá